Is a 2006 Pontiac G6 GT a good car?
Driving. In terms of power, the four-cylinder 2006 Pontiac G6 compares favorably with competitors’ base engines but is lacking in refinement. The fuel-efficient 3.5-liter V6 offers plenty of torque down low for easy passing and merging, but can also get a bit thrashy at high revs.

Are there any problems with the Pontiac G6?
Steering problems are a fairly common concern among Pontiac G6 owners. In some 2006 models, the power steering can cut out while driving at low speeds. The unexpected loss of power steering can catch drivers off guard and increases the risk of a road accident.
What should I do if I lose power steering on my Pontiac G6?
The unexpected loss of power steering can catch drivers off guard and increases the risk of a road accident. Replacing the Pontiac G6 steering rack, steering column, or power assist motor usually resolves the issue. However, repairs can be expensive.
